Market Size and Overview


The Australia Podcasting Market is estimated to be valued at USD 3.13 Bn in 2025 and is expected to reach USD 4.37 Bn by 2032, growing at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 4.9% from 2025 to 2032.


Market Drivers


A key market driver influencing the Australia podcasting market is the surge in interactive and localized content production. In 2024, Southern Cross Austereo (SCA) reported a 25% increase in listener engagement following the launch of region-specific shows, which created significant market opportunities by catering to niche audiences. This driver is critical in market growth strategies, facilitating increased advertising revenues while addressing evolving consumer demands. Furthermore, enhanced monetization options like subscription-based models continue to propel Australia Podcasting Market Dynamics forward.

PEST Analysis


- Political: The Australian government’s supportive stance on digital infrastructure investment in 2025, including subsidies for regional connectivity, is favorable for expanding podcast audience reach and market scope.
- Economic: A stable economy with rising disposable incomes has led to increased advertising spends on digital audio platforms, fueling market revenue growth in 2024-2025.
- Social: Changing lifestyle trends, particularly among millennials and Gen Z, demonstrate a growing preference for podcasts as a source of entertainment and information, significantly impacting industry trends.
- Technological: Advances in AI-driven content curation and targeted ad-tech in 2024 have improved user experience and advertiser ROI, providing a boost to market companies focusing on innovation.

Promotion and Marketing Initiatives


In 2025, Spotify launched a comprehensive marketing initiative involving cross-promotion across social media and exclusive podcast content partnerships with Australian celebrities. This strategy amplified brand visibility and subscriptions by 30%, proving highly effective in expanding market share and driving business growth. Other market players have adopted similar digital-first marketing approaches, leveraging influencer collaborations to enhance consumer engagement.

Key Players


- ARN (Australian Radio Network): Introduced new multi-genre podcast series in 2024, leading to a 15% increase in listener base.
- SCA (Southern Cross Austereo): Expanded regional podcast studios in 2025, enhancing localized content production.
- Nova Entertainment: Launched an innovative advertising platform tailored for podcasts in 2024, boosting ad revenues.
- Spotify: Strengthened exclusive content deals in 2025, fortifying its market share in the Australia podcasting market.
- Apple Podcasts: Rolled out enhanced analytics and monetization tools in 2024, aiding creators in audience growth and retention.

Other notable market companies contributing to the Australia podcasting market growth include PodcastOne Australia, iHeartRadio Australia, Audible, Google Podcasts, Acast, TuneIn, and Podbean. Collectively, these market players have adopted aggressive market growth strategies including strategic partnerships, product innovation, and digital marketing, driving overall industry size and revenue expansion.
